Quote:
It's for employees & immediate family only. It's only a 6 month scheme too. No option to buy after the 6 month term as it's purely a lease. Good thing is, you get your own insurance so it's personal choice as to who can drive it. You don't take any hit for taxing the car regardless of list price, and any service requirements or work it may need (including tyres) is all included. He's just got a new (1st March) registered M140i for his other half, which I believe is £234 per month. Which over the 6 months is miles cheaper than the depreciation if bought.
